How Discover the Truth About Mesquite, TX Jail Inmates Actually Works

Understanding the process begins with recognizing that information about inmates is largely public, governed by open records laws. To Discover the Truth About Mesquite, TX Jail Inmates, one would typically start by accessing official databases maintained by the city or county sheriff’s office. These records often include details such as names, booking dates, charges, and estimated release dates, though sensitive personal information is usually protected. For example, a concerned neighbor might search for booking logs to verify if someone they know has been taken into custody for a minor offense. It is important to approach these records with context, as arrest details do not always reflect the final outcome of a case. Some individuals may be released quickly, while others await trial, making it essential to avoid drawing conclusions from incomplete data.

Common Questions People Have About Discover the Truth About Mesquite, TX Jail Inmates

Many people wonder how they can find accurate information without navigating confusing government websites. The most reliable method is to visit the official portal of the Mesquite Police Department or the Dallas County Sheriff’s Office. These sites often provide inmate search tools that are updated regularly. Another frequent question is whether these records include mugshots or detailed personal histories. While some platforms may display booking photos, the availability of such images can depend on local policies and privacy considerations. People also ask about the timeframe for updates; because processing times vary, there can be delays between an arrest and the appearance of records online. By using official channels, individuals can ensure they are viewing current and lawful information rather than outdated or unverified content.

Things People Often Misunderstand

A common myth is that discovering information about inmates provides a complete picture of their character or guilt. In reality, the legal process is complex, and cases can take months or even years to resolve. Another misunderstanding is that all arrest data is automatically published with full details. Many records are sealed to protect minors, victims, or sensitive investigations. People may also assume that every city maintains the same level of online accessibility, but procedures differ based on jurisdiction and available technology. By clarifying these points, individuals can approach their research with a more nuanced perspective, avoiding the pitfalls of misinformation.
